| Subject: The Short (But Delicious) Guide for Beginners Sun Jul 26, 2009 6:12 pm | |
| When you first start up the client, type your username then press enter on your keyboard. Then, type the password that you want. First, you can change the look of your character using the interface that pops up. If you ever want to change your look again, just click on the Makeover Mage who is located somewhat below the banking unit, above the building with all the npcs.Here's what he looks like ---> When you first log on, you have 1mil, some armour/weapons, and tooons of runes. Just bank those (besides the iron scimmy and strength ammy), because you won't really need them until later. If you want to purchase clothes (berets, event clothing, etc), talk to Thessalia who is inside the building with all the npcs @ home. Picture ---> If you want to purchase skiller items, talk to Barker who is located in the skiller area (Monster tele option). (couldn't find a similar picture).The woman (Alrena) in the npc building at home sells food and pots which you will need later on. If you want weps or armour, trade Niles or Giles, who are also located in the building. You can sell anything to Siegfried Erkle, who is right below the banking unit at home, to make extra money.After you've gotten all your supplies, teleport to Beginner Training. If you want to go somewhere else, it doesn't really matter, but beginner training is the best place to train at if you're a low level. So, if you go to Beginner Training to train, do not click on the Fear Reaper until you are a fairly high level with the ability to do melee prayer. The Baby Blue Dragons do not do damage to you, so feel free to attack those until you're satisfied. Tips on generating money: You can craft and resell the ammys that you make for more money. You can also collect dragon bones (there is a bank at Beginner Training) and then sell them to Barker. Also, once you reach a high level (100 or so) attack the Reaper. You might recieve wings or a sacred whip from him. Also, minigames help make you money too as the monsters in certain ones drop rare armour. Theiving is bugged right now, so it glitches your client everytime you level.Hope this helped a little!
